2004 Licensing Round
The 2004 JDZ Licensing Round is based on an open competitive tender with applications evaluated on the basis of standard technical and commercial criteria. The Licensing Round is the second international competitive bidding round arranged by the Joint Development Authority, and follows a period of consultation with industry. Industry activity in neighbouring Nigeria and Equatorial Guinea has been significant, and recent multi-client 2D and 3D seismic data acquired within the JDZ suggests that similar levels of activity are warranted here.

| The areas of the Blocks on offer in the 2004 JDZ Licensing Round are given below: | ||||||||
|
|
||||||||
|
Block
Number
Block 2 Block 3 Block 4 Block 5 Block 6 |
Area
(sq kms)
692 666 857 1091 588 |
